For the majority of first-time home buyers, saving enough money for a down payment is the biggest hurdle to owning a achieving the American dream and owning a home. Traditionally, lenders have required a down payment of as much as 20% of the purchase price. However, lenders now are willing to accept less than that (provided that the borrower takes out private mortgage insurance, or PMI). In recent years, innovative programs have made it possible to put down as little as 0% of the value of a home and still qualify for a mortgage through zero down home loans. However, there are some advantages to putting some money down on a home. Should you put any cash down? If you do, you'll immediately have some equity in your home. In addition, you'll avoid paying private mortgage insurance (which can be costly). In the end, the decision on whether you should put down zero, 5%, 10%, 20% or any other amount is totally up to you. This decision will be influenced by your financial situation, your preferences and the type of loan you qualify for. If you are financially secure, you may want to go ahead and put down some money. Conversely, you may find that by putting down as little as possible, you will have that much more to invest with. In many cases, your money will be earning more for you than it would have being tied up in your home!
